Zenith Open House June 20

On Saturday, June 20, 2015, Zenith Aircraft owners and enthusiasts from all over North America will converge on the factory in Mexico, Missouri, to exchange tips and stories, and meet and welcome new and future Zenith builders and fliers attending this eighth springtime celebration of homebuilding.

From 8 a.m. and 2 p.m. visitors can enjoy self-guided factory tours, demonstrations, and a good look at the factory lineup of aircraft, with coffee and donuts in the morning, and a hot lunch.

“All the visitors need to do is bring their enthusiasm and tie-downs, and maybe a lawn chair” Zenith Aircraft Company President Sebastien Heintz said. “We provide the venue, the airplanes, and the ambiance.”

Unlike the traditional Open Hangar Days in September, which host forums and technical sessions, June’s Fly In To Summer is “informal and unstructured, keeping with the joy of summertime flying and the urge to spend the long daylight hours looking down on Earth from a cool, comfortable altitude.”www.zenith.aero/profiles/blogs/fly-in-to-summer-2015
